I shut Ryan Hardin down without a hint of hesitation.

 

Ryan froze for a moment. After all, this was the first time I had ever told him “no” in the past nine years.

 

Frowning, he gave me a slow once-over. “Daisy Boyle, have you lost your mind? Or is your neurotic wolf acting up again?”

 

I stared at him with a poker face.

 

After a while, Ryan grew uncomfortable under my gaze and waved me off. “Fine. You don’t want to do it? Then, don’t ever do it again. Don’t expect me to show you any courtesy next time.”

 

He waved over a maid and barked, “Bring out breakfast.”

 

Just then, the Omega he brought home last night, Clare Lambert, giggled as she sauntered up beside me. “Daisy, did you learn those exciting positions we tried last night?”

 

As soon as she said that, Ryan yanked her back by the arm. “Cut it out. Go clean up and eat.”

 

Clare threw me a dazzling smile over her shoulder and mouthed the word “loser” at me.

 

At breakfast, she sat beside Ryan, all hushed whispers and flirtatious laughs.

 

Seeing that, I felt like someone had carved a hole in my chest. I kept wondering where I should go once I left.

 

Suddenly, someone tapped me gently on the arm. I looked up to see Ryan standing beside me with a stern expression.

 

“What?” I asked softly.

 

He gave me a complicated look. “What were you just thinking about? I called you twice, and you didn’t hear me.”

 

I turned back toward the table and replied coolly, “I was thinking about what I want to do next.”

 

Ryan sneered. “What could you possibly do? Mop floors? Serve food?”

 

The insult came so naturally to him. But it didn’t sting. Perhaps I had grown numb.

 

Nine years of marriage had scraped me down to nothing. I had lost myself entirely. My world spun around him as I lived only to serve and please.

 

I had forgotten the version of me who used to have dreams.

 

Nine years ago, when Grandpa—who raised me—was caught in a silver mine trap, I was helpless and desperate. That was when Ryan appeared.

 

He handed me a million dollars, but there was a price. I had to sign a mate agreement and play his partner to deal with a dispute with Campbell Pack.

 

I agreed for Grandpa.
